We’re excited to have been enlisted by another fantastic client this week – Manchester’s very own The Printworks! Yes, the JAMpr team will be supporting the iconic entertainment complex with all its PR activity over the next 12 months, raising the profile of the venue and its 20 tenants, which include Hard Rock Cafe, Prezzo, Bierkeller, Virgin Active gym and Odeon cinema, as well as other popular dining and socialising outlets.
To kick off, we’re supporting The Printworks with its exciting Design A New Mascot competition this month, so we’ll be looking for budding artists in the region to submit creative designs. The winning entry will win a once in a lifetime prize by having their mascot brought to life by Hollywood special effects make up artist and sculptor, Shaune Harrison, who created make up for Voldemort from Harry Potter, Red Skull from Captain America, as well as many other well known movie characters.
